If walls could talk, then this homes story would be a best seller I'm sure, oozing with character and charm its difficult to know where to start, so here we go.
A Georgian terraced house, arranged over three floors and offering generous and flexible accommodation which has so many benefits, but here are just a few, the rest really need to be seen.
The first thing you notice is the character of the property with its high ceilings, sash windows, original shutters etc as well as a large fireplace which intrigues you with what type of seafaring gentry used to live here.

There flexibility comes from the basement level with two very generous reception rooms, the largest of which enjoys its own Kitchen area. The basement also benefits from its own entrance, so perhaps you have a family member who would love their own space, close enough to keep an eye on but ultimately with their own independent living space.

In need of some modernisation works, the home offers the next owners the opportunity to place their own stamp on the property and have it as you desire. It also comes to the market chain free, making the purchase straight forward.

Then there is the sea directly behind the property giving you panoramic views of the Thames estuary, envisage waking up on the warm summer mornings with the window open and the waves gently lapping along the shoreline. Keen fishing folk can grab their rods and head over to see what you and the children can catch on the beach behind your 60ft garden. Then perhaps take a short stroll into town to sample the delights of the local market or a quick tipple in The Royal Public house.     Broadband availability and predicted speed: obtained from Ofcom on August 2, 2022

    Broadband speed is measured in megabits per second, with the number returned showing how fast the connection is. Each reading is based on the highest predicted speed of any major broadband network for services that deliver the download speeds. The following are the different readings that we may display:

    Basic: Up to 30 Mbit/s
    Super-fast: Between 30 Mbit/s and 300 Mbit/s
    Ultra-fast: Over 300 Mbit/s

    The data is updated three times a year. The checker results are predictions and should not be regarded as guaranteed. For more information, see: https://checker.ofcom.org.uk/en-gb/about-checker#Answer_0_2
